AT&T International Day Pass

Tigo PY operates the 4G LTE towers in Paraguay. AT&T resells access at $10/day. An eSIM accesses Tigo PY directly from $2.65/GB.

Verizon TravelPass

Verizon does not require you to enable the $10/day Paraguay pass manually. Your phone connects to Tigo PY automatically on landing. The charge appears unless data roaming is switched off before the plane door opens.

T-Mobile Magenta (high-speed add-on)

Tigo PY operates the 4G LTE towers in Paraguay. T-Mobile resells access at $15/day. An eSIM accesses Tigo PY directly from $2.65/GB.

Xfinity Mobile International Pass

Xfinity Mobile's day pass in Paraguay activates the moment your phone connects to Tigo PY's network abroad — including the two minutes of background data sync when you land. A full $10 charge runs whether you use 10MB or 10GB that day.

How much data do I need for a week in Paraguay?
Most travelers use 1-2 GB per day for maps, messaging, social media, and light browsing. A 7-day trip needs 7-14 GB. Video calls and streaming push usage to 3+ GB per day. Choose a 10GB or 20GB plan for heavy use.
Can a family share one eSIM in Paraguay?
One eSIM stays in one phone, but most eSIM plans allow tethering (personal hotspot). A family of 4 can share a single 10-20GB eSIM through one phone's hotspot instead of paying $10/day per person for carrier roaming.
Does T-Mobile free data work in Paraguay?
T-Mobile Magenta includes free data in Paraguay, but speed is capped at 256 Kbps. That is too slow for Google Maps, video calls, or uploading photos. The high-speed add-on costs $15/day.

How much does carrier roaming cost in Paraguay?
If you land in Paraguay without activating a roaming plan, AT&T bills $2.05 per megabyte. A 10-second Google Maps load at 1.5 MB costs $3.08. Ten minutes of casual app use: $30–$60. AT&T's day pass caps the damage at $10/day. A travel eSIM on Tigo PY at $5.49 for 1GB is the only option with a fixed, predictable total cost from day one.
Is T-Mobile's free international data fast enough in Paraguay?
No. To use Paraguay as a normal traveler — ride-hailing, mapping, messaging with photos — you need at minimum 1 Mbps. T-Mobile's free tier delivers 256 Kbps, which is one-quarter of that floor. The high-speed add-on costs $15/day. A travel eSIM connects to Tigo PY's 4G LTE network at $2.65/GB — the same towers, real speeds, no daily charge trigger.
How is my roaming bill calculated in Paraguay?
Carriers bill Paraguay roaming two ways. AT&T and Verizon use per-day billing at $10/day — the charge triggers even if a background app syncs at 11:59 PM. Without a day pass, AT&T bills $2.05 per MB ($2,099/GB). T-Mobile provides free data at 256 Kbps but charges $15/day for usable speed. An eSIM plan at 1GB for $5.49 is a one-time purchase with no per-day triggers and no usage surprises.
Which phone brands support eSIM for travel in Paraguay?
eSIM-compatible phones confirmed for Paraguay: Apple iPhone XS and later (all models), Google Pixel 3 and later, Samsung Galaxy S20 and later, Samsung Galaxy Z series, Motorola Razr 2019 and later, Microsoft Surface Duo. Budget Android phones under $300 typically do not include an eSIM chip. iPhone 15 and later US models are eSIM-only with no physical SIM tray. Before purchasing a plan for Paraguay, confirm eSIM support by checking Settings > General > About > Digital SIM (iOS) or Settings > Network > SIM Manager (Android). Rates checked June 2026.
Is Google Fi better than a travel eSIM for Paraguay?
Google Fi Flexible plan charges $0.01/MB ($10/GB) in Paraguay. Fi Plus and Fi Unlimited include Paraguay data at full speed within plan limits at no extra charge. For a week at 1.5 GB/day: Fi Flexible costs $105. A travel eSIM on Tigo PY at $2.65/GB costs roughly $27.83 for the same usage. If you are already a Google Fi subscriber, the included data has no additional cost. If you are on AT&T or Verizon, switching to Fi for one trip does not make financial sense — a travel eSIM at $2.65/GB is the lower-cost path. Rates checked June 2026.
